What regenerative options do aesthetic practices use most?
Microneedling with fractional dermal infusion, PRP for skin quality and hair, low-level and high-power laser therapy, and topical exosome or growth-factor serums applied after controlled skin injury.
How many sessions do skin-quality protocols need?
Three to six sessions spaced three to four weeks apart is the common template, with maintenance every six to twelve months. Collagen remodeling continues for months after the final session.
Is downtime significant?
Most device-based regenerative aesthetic protocols involve 24 to 72 hours of erythema and mild swelling. They are far lower-downtime than ablative resurfacing.
Can these protocols be combined with injectables?
Yes, with sequencing rules. We provide staging templates so energy-based and needling treatments do not disrupt recently placed neuromodulators or fillers.
